Abstract |
Introduction: Tc-99m-(V)-DMSA is a tumor seeking agent
that has been used to image medullary carcinoma of
thyroid, soft tissue sarcoma and lung cancer. This
study was designed to assess the clinical role of Tc-
99m-(V)-DMSA in the diagnosis of head and neck cancers.
We has evaluated the diagnostic efficacy of planar and
SPECT imaging using Tc-99m-(V)-DMSA. Patients and
Method: Sixty-eight patients with head and neck mass
were included in this study. All subjects were
diagnosed by biopsy or surgery. Planar and SPECT images
were obtained at 2 or 3 hour after intravenous
injection of 740 MBq(20 mCi) Tc-99m-(V)-DMSA. Seventeen
patients also underwent SPECT imaging using dual head
camera. Results: The diagnostic sensitivity of Tc-99m-
(V)-DMSA planar and SPECT imaging was 65% and 90%, and
specificity was 80% and 66%, respectively. The
sensitivity of planar imaging in squamous cell
carcinoma was similar to overall sensitivity. Six
metastatic lesion were first diagnosed by scintigraphy.
But benign lesions such as Kikuchi syndrome,
tuberculous lymphadenitis also revealed increased
uptake. Conclusion: Tc-99m-(V)-DMSA imaging seems to be
a promising method in the evaluation of patients with
head and neck mass. We recommend SPECT imaging to
delineate anatomic localization of the lesion. |
